Psychiatric Nurse Practitioner (PMHNP) – Child & Adolescent Psychiatry (Part-Time) Worcester, Massachusetts UMass Memorial Health is seeking a Part-Time Psychiatric Nurse Practitioner (PMHNP) to join our Child & Adolescent Psychiatry team. This position offers the opportunity to work within a collaborative, multidisciplinary academic health system dedicated to providing high-quality behavioral health care to children and families across Central Massachusetts. Position Overview The Psychiatric Nurse Practitioner, in consultation with the designated supervising psychiatrist, is primarily responsible for providing psychiatric evaluation, brief treatment, and medication management to patients ranging from children and adolescents to young adulthood across the designated service population. The need for psychiatric services may be generated by a primary mental health condition or secondary to co-existing medical conditions. The PMHNP will work closely with psychiatrists, therapists, nursing staff, and other healthcare professionals to ensure coordinated and comprehensive patient care. The UMass outpatient OCI High-Risk Nurse Care Manager (RN) role focuses on the following: The High-Risk Care Manager is a PCP-embedded role that provides longitudinal care management for medically complex adult patients in the ambulatory setting. Using strong clinical judgment and critical thinking, the Care Manager develops, implements, and monitors comprehensive care plans that support chronic disease management, care transitions, and patient self-management. The Care Manager partners closely with PCPs, specialists, care teams, patients, and caregivers to coordinate care across the continuum, including hospitals, SNFs, home care, and community resources. Responsibilities include outreach, patient engagement, post-discharge follow-up, health coaching, goal setting, and ensuring timely communication of care plans. UMass Memorial Health is seeking a Per Diem Nurse Practitioner to join the Care mobile team to provide care to the community. The UMass Memorial Health Ronald McDonald Care Mobile delivers an innovative, community-based model of medical services and preventive dental care to the vulnerable, socioeconomically disadvantaged, uninsured and undocumented children and their families living in Worcester County. The Care Mobile services 28 Worcester public and charter schools with nine neighborhood sites across the city and surrounding towns. Our routine sites include neighborhood and community centers, churches, and apartment complexes. The advanced practice position needs to be an FNP or PA, as we see children and adults, with a minimum of 1-day shift per month which will be 6-7 hours (typically, 9am-4pm) on the Care Mobile or in the community . Day Kimball Health is hiring for a Quality Data Coordinator Registered Nurse for the Quality and Risk Management Full Time Day Shift 40-Hours job in Putnam, CT. Registered Nurse (RN) Benefits: Medical/Dental/Vision Pharmacy Plan Basic & Supplemental Life Insurance Short- & Long-Term Disability Health Savings Account or Flexible Spending Account Accident & Critical Illness Coverage 401K Plan with Eligible Employer Contribution Vacation Time Sick Days Paid Holidays Education Reimbursement Pet Insurance Additional Benefits Registered Nurse (RN) Job Summary: As the Quality Data Coordinator (RN), you will be under the direction of the Director of Quality Improvement/Risk Management, overseeing the process of gathering healthcare system core measure and meaningful use data to ensure the completeness of data collection. Assists in ensuring the validity, integrity and reliability of the healthcare’s performance measures data. healthcare. Registered Nurse (RN) Job Responsibilities: Oversees and Coordinates the accurate and timely process of data collection to meet core measure and meaningful use deadlines. Prepares reports of these data quarterly and as requested. Chairs the Core Measure Committee. Performs chart review to ensure complete collection of healthcare performance core measure data. Ensure healthcare performance core measure data validity, integrity, and reliability. Responsible for National/State Report Card and Core Measure data retrieval, entry and reporting processes. Responsible for the organization and maintenance of required documentation of National/State Report Card and Core Measures reports, meeting minutes, etc. Aids in problem identification and refers as appropriate to the Director, QI/RM. Assists in follow up investigation of reported variances. Assists in preparing trended variance reports for review at various committees. Serves as a member in our SSE review and analysis. Serves as a key team member in conducting root cause analysis. Coordinating activities for TOC. Serves in an active role with regulatory and / or Joint Commission Surveys.
